About Cinitapride

Cinitapride is used in the treatment and prevention of heartburn, functional dyspepsia, inflammation of esophagus and acid secretion by the stomach.

Before using this medication you should notify your doctor if you are allergic to any ingredient contained within it, you are allergic to any food or medicine or substance. You must also consult your doctor if you have gastrointestinal bleeding or movement problems, you are taking any prescription or non-prescription drugs or herbal products or dietary supplements.

The dosage for this medication should be determined by the doctor based on your age, overall medical history and the severity of your current condition. The usual dose in adults is 1 mg, to be taken orally thrice per day. The medicine needs to be taken on an empty stomach at least 15 minutes before your meals.

    How does this medication work?

    This medication is a gastroprokinetic substance that acts as an antiulcer agent. It works by activating the 5-HT4 and 5-HT1 receptors. At the same time, it deactivates the 5-HT2 receptors, which helps prevent the symptoms of GERD and other gastrointestinal issues.
